Not Installing Your Dishwashing Machine Properly Can Cause a Hill of Troubles
Not only can setting up a dishwashing machine properly nullify your guarantee, but it can also create a mess. If you do not mount the supply line properly, you can deal with leaks-- or even worse, a flooding. You may also exper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also quickly via your pipes as well as creates loud trembling noises. If you incorrectly install your dish washer to the trash disposal, you might notice pungent smells or have residue on your dishes.

A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dishwashing machine connector, links the dishwashing machine to a water resource. If you get a brand-new supply line, a plumber can make sure that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ine and also water source. If you make a decision to utilize an existing supply line, a specialist plumber can check it to make sure that it's in good condition and also does not have any leakages.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
